    We sell sequential kits for the mustangs. You can pick up our 96-04 kit. That will only accomplish what bfranker is calling the Basic install. You will have to purchase the additional socket and modify your taillight assembly to do what he calls the full install.

    To get the third light to work, yes... The third light is not dual element and would need to be converted.
